Method in Identifying the Parameters of Magic Formula Tire Model Based on New Self-adaptive Differential Evolution

Abstract: According to the situation that the fixed control parameters and evolutionary strategy of traditional differential evolution cannot be adapted to complex problems, a new self-adaptive differential evolution(NSADE) is presented, and further utilized to overcome the difficulty of identifying the parameters of magic formula(MF) tire model. The algorithm combines the selection strategy of control parameters based on the successfully evolutionary individuals and the evolutionary strategy based on dual trial vectors to achieve the effective self-adaptation of control parameters. By the identification of lateral force parameters and aligning moment parameters for pure slip, the new algorithm is demonstrated to have more powerful ability of global optimization and fast convergence than the other two advanced self-adaptive differential evolution,IMMa optimization algorithm(IOA) and differential evolution with self-adapting strategy and control parameters(SspDE), and the identified results are more accurate than that of the traditional Levenberg-Marquardt method, which indicates NSADE is an efficient method to identify the parameters of MF tire model.
